本发明涉及传感器,尤其涉及一种传感器补偿方法、装置、系统及电子设备。
背景技术:
1、传感器芯片被广泛应用于数据存储、电流测量、位移车辆等测量领域,工作环境的变化会对传感器芯片的稳定性与可靠性造成影响。
2、相关技术中,为了对传感器进行补偿,采用的方法包括多项式拟合方法、插值方法、分段线性补偿方法、曲线拟合方法、神经网络方法、统计建模方法等。
3、然而,相关技术中的传感器补偿方法,均为对传感器进行实时补偿,需要复杂算法和高速处理器,存在芯片的性能短板,而且散热多、功耗高,不能满足边缘应用的要求。
技术实现思路
1、本发明旨在至少在一定程度上解决相关技术中的技术问题之一。为此,本发明的第一个目的在于提出一种传感器补偿方法,以实现降低补偿所需要的算法要求与成本。
2、本发明的第二个目的在于提出一种电子设备。
3、本发明的第三个目的在于提出一种传感器补偿装置。
4、本发明的第四个目的在于提出一种传感器补偿系统。
5、为达到上述目的,本发明第一方面实施例提出了一种传感器补偿方法,所述方法包括:获取传感器的基准数据和多个实际输出数据;针对每个所述实际输出数据,均根据所述基准数据与该实际输出数据计算得到对应的误差值;将所述误差值与预设值进行比较;当比较结果为小于所述预设值时,将小于所述预设值的误差值存入所述查找表存储器,以用于对所述传感器进行查表补偿;当比较结果为大于或等于所述预设值时,根据大于或等于所述预设值的误差值和所述实际输出数据计算得到实际补偿数据,并将所述实际补偿数据和预设补偿数据进行比较,根据比较结果对所述误差值进行更新,返回所述将所述误差值与预设值进行比较的步骤。
6、为达到上述目的,本发明第二方面实施例提出了一种电子设备,包括存储器、处理器和存储在存储器上并可在处理器上运行的计算机程序,所述计算机程序被所述处理器执行时,实现上述的传感器补偿方法。
7、为达到上述目的,本发明第三方面实施例提出了一种传感器补偿装置,所述装置包括:获取模块,用于获取传感器的基准数据和多个实际输出数据;计算模块,针对每个所述实际输出数据,均根据所述基准数据与该实际输出数据计算得到对应的误差值;比较模块,用于将所述误差值与预设值进行比较,以及在得到实际补偿数据后,将所述实际补偿数据和预设补偿数据进行比较;存储模块,用于在所述误差值与所述预设值的比较结果为小于所述预设值时,将小于所述预设值的误差值存入所述查找表存储器,以使所述查找表存储器根据所述误差值对所述传感器进行补偿;其中,所述计算模块还用于在所述误差值与预设值的比较结果为大于或等于所述预设值时,根据大于或等于所述预设值的误差值和所述实际输出数据计算得到所述实际补偿数据,以及,根据所述实际补偿数据和所述预设补偿数据的比较结果对所述误差值进行更新,以使所述比较模块将新的误差值与预设值进行比较。
8、为达到上述目的,本发明第四方面实施例提出了一种传感器补偿系统,包括:传感器、查找表存储器和上述的电子设备。
9、本发明实施例的传感器补偿方法、装置、系统及电子设备,获取传感器的基准数据和多个实际输出数据;针对每个实际输出数据,均根据基准数据与该实际输出数据计算得到对应的误差值;将误差值与预设值进行比较;当比较结果为小于预设值时,将小于预设值的误差值存入查找表存储器,以用于对传感器进行查表补偿;当比较结果为大于或等于预设值时,根据大于或等于预设值的误差值和实际输出数据计算得到实际补偿数据,并将实际补偿数据和预设补偿数据进行比较,根据比较结果对误差值进行更新,返回将误差值与预设值进行比较的步骤。由此,通过循环迭代的方式预先获取最优的补偿数据,实现降低补偿所需要的算法要求与成本。
10、本发明附加的方面和优点将在下面的描述中部分给出,部分将从下面的描述中变得明显,或通过本发明的实践了解到。
1.一种传感器补偿方法,其特征在于,所述方法包括:
2.根据权利要求1所述的传感器补偿方法,其特征在于,所述传感器为温度传感器,所述根据所述基准数据与该实际输出数据计算得到对应的误差值包括:
3.根据权利要求2所述的传感器补偿方法,其特征在于,所述根据所述环境温度、所述最低工作温度、所述最低工作温度时的误差、所述最高工作温度和所述第一差值计算得到对应的误差值,包括:
4.根据权利要求3所述的传感器补偿方法,其特征在于,根据下式计算得到所述一阶温度误差:
5.根据权利要求4所述的传感器补偿方法,其特征在于,根据下式计算得到所述二阶温度误差:
6.根据权利要求4所述的传感器补偿方法,其特征在于,根据下式计算得到所述误差值:
7.根据权利要求1所述的传感器补偿方法,其特征在于,所述传感器为氮化镓传感器,所述查找表存储器为氮化镓查找表存储器。
8.一种电子设备,其特征在于,包括存储器、处理器和存储在存储器上并可在处理器上运行的计算机程序,所述计算机程序被所述处理器执行时,实现如权利要求1-7中任一项所述的传感器补偿方法。
9.一种传感器补偿装置,其特征在于,所述装置包括:
10.一种传感器补偿系统,其特征在于,包括:传感器、查找表存储器和如权利要求8所述的电子设备。